The Oslo Jazz Festival is seeking a curious and music-interested production intern for a five-week engagement in summer 2026.

The Oslo Jazz Festival (OJF) is a non-profit foundation that, since its founding in 1986, has organized a week-long festival with around 100 concerts in mid-August. The festival takes place across the city’s many concert venues and clubs, presenting a broad and contemporary jazz program ranging from international stars to more niche expressions.

Oslojazz Talent is a comprehensive talent development program for jazz students during the Oslo Jazz Festival. Eight bands are selected for four intensive days of networking, communication, learning, and inspiration. Through interaction with the festival, industry professionals, and each other, the goal is to provide participants with valuable experience they can carry into their professional careers as jazz musicians.

Job desription

As an intern at the Oslo Jazz Festival, you will experience the fast-paced and exciting life of a festival from the inside. The production intern works with planning and executing the Oslojazz Talent program in close collaboration with the festival producer. This role gives you the opportunity to work independently on one of Oslo Jazz’s key sub-projects and gain insight into everything from technical production and backline to transport logistics and meal planning.

We are looking for someone with a strong understanding of project work, including thorough preparation, clear communication, and independent follow-up during execution. The position is full-time for five weeks, from July 13 to August 16. During the festival itself, evening and weekend work should be expected. Some post-festival evaluation work is also included.
